Lara ends Border's reign

Brian Lara sets run-scoring world record

Lara made a brilliant 226 to lift his career tally to 11,187 from 121 tests, eclipsing the previous record of 11,174 held by former Australian captain Allan Border.

Lara ends Border's reign

West Indian batting superstar Brian Lara became the greatest run scorer in Test cricket during his epic double-century in the third Test against Australia at the Adelaide Oval on Saturday.

The 36-year-old Trinidad great, 12 runs off the record on his overnight score of 202, went past Allan Border's world record aggregate of 11,174 runs early on the second day's play.

Lara's 405-minute masterpiece was finally ended when he was bowled by Glenn McGrath for 226, leaving him with a Test aggregate of 11,187 runs at an average of 54.04 in his 121st Test match.

Lara sweeps past Border

Brian Lara has spent his cricketing life exciting fans with spectacular deeds and he marked his step into Test run-scoring's unknown with an extraordinary single. A swept boundary moved Allan Border past Sunil Gavaskar's record in 1993 and Lara used a similar method when he bravely shuffled across his stumps to paddle Glenn McGrath to fine-leg for a single, his 214th run of the innings and his 11,175th over 15 years.

The beautiful ground rose again and Australia's players formed a casual line to offer their congratulations as Lara's team-mates stood with hands high in the dressing room. Lara was pleased but calm - and probably tired after making 202 on day one - and hugged Daren Powell before accepting the opposition's compliments.
